ok originally this laptop had windows vista and a 250gb HD that was partitioned into 70gb for the C: drive and the rest for the E: drive.

I wiped the laptop 100% clean of everything even OS and now with the fresh windows 7 install it just has a single drive of 232GB, Should I partition this and keep the C: drive clean and use the other part to keep all my music,movies, downloads, etc.?

Thanks

cmspaz
07-17-2011, 08:50 PM
Realistically that's more of an organizational choice (i.e. up to you), but in the end it's easier to be able to just wipe a partition and reinstall than it is to have to back up all of your crap before you can even think about doing anything.

If it were me, keeping the second partition is advantageous.

Just delete all the partitions on your hard drive using the install cd and then click the new button and make just 1 partition and windows will automatically make a small partition buffer so you don't max your hardrive and cause problems. You could make a 16gb partition for your operating system so it runs a little faster but realistically it's not a big deal and if you run out of room on the operating system partition you've got problems. I always do 1 partition on laptops, just did 1 on my notebook the otherday. An advantage to the multiple partitions would be that if you ever corrupted you operating system you could just reinstall over you OS partition and still keep all your movies and pics on the drive without transferring them. Since I have a desktop I could care less about this and transferring fills off a corrupt hard drive is not that hard to do.

Just make a 40gb os partition and another partition for movies with whats left over, you might be happy you did later.
